VibeFlow vs n8n, side by side

Feature VibeFlow n8n
Visual node-based editor Yes Yes
AI generates the workflow from a prompt Yes AI nodes only (you still build it)
Frontend builder (forms, dashboards) Yes -
Built-in hosted database Yes BYO (Postgres etc.)
Code export TypeScript + GitHub sync JSON workflow definition
Self-host Roadmap Yes (Docker, Helm, etc.)
Open-source license Closed-source (export your code) Sustainable Use License
Hosting included Yes Cloud plans only
Code nodes / custom JS Generated for you Required for advanced flows
Pricing Per-seat ($49/mo) Per-execution or self-host

n8n cloud starts at €20/mo (limited executions). Self-hosting is free but you pay in DevOps time. VibeFlow Business is $49/seat/mo with hosting included, AI workflow generation, and a built-in frontend stack.

n8n vs VibeFlow - FAQ

Is VibeFlow open-source like n8n?

VibeFlow is closed-source today, but every workflow you build can be exported as TypeScript and run on your own infrastructure. We're evaluating an open-core release. Either way, your code is yours - no lock-in.

Can VibeFlow do everything n8n does?

For 95% of real-world automation work, yes. n8n has more obscure built-in nodes today (we're catching up fast), but VibeFlow's AI can write any custom logic you describe in TypeScript, so the gap shrinks every week.

Can I self-host VibeFlow like I self-host n8n?

Self-hosting is on the Enterprise roadmap. In the meantime, you can already export your workflows and run them anywhere - that's the same end result, without the infra burden of running the editor.

How is the AI different from n8n's AI nodes?

n8n's AI nodes are LLM calls inside a workflow you still build by hand. VibeFlow uses AI to build the workflow itself - the graph, the nodes, the database schema, even the frontend. You describe the outcome, we generate the system.
